>> Hi Hesham,
>> 
>> the text in question is defined as marked content in the PDF and not as 
>> 'regular text'. I think its wrongly handled/not fully supported (I don't 
>> know what the implementation status is) in pdfbox (and some other apps I 
>> tested with) but is correctly handled in Adobe Reader.
